Friday, March 7, 2008

The self proclaimed Master of Magnetism. ...soon to have his own movie as well.

1 comment:

  1. (:o Mr. DUng and BEetle???!!!

    ):}) AMazing!!

    And I love the Turtles. Just rented the CG movie that came out last year.


